The Lower Door Gasket is an OEM part for GE dishwashers. It is placed at the bottom of the dishwasher door to create a water-tight seal during operation, preventing leaks and ensuring that water remains within the unit during the wash cycle.
Symptoms of a bad Lower Door Gasket include:
- Water leaking from the bottom of the dishwasher door
- Signs of mold or mildew near the gasket area
- Frequent puddles or drips underneath the door after a wash cycle
- The gasket becoming hard, cracked, or visibly damaged
Causes of a bad Lower Door Gasket can include regular wear and tear, exposure to harsh detergents and high temperatures, or improper installation that leads to uneven sealing.

The Door Latch is an OEM replacement part for GE dishwashers. It serves the critical function of securely keeping the door closed during wash cycles through its engaging bolt design.
Over extended use, aspects of the latch can degrade such as worn plastic catch areas, loosened screws, or a faulty latch hook mechanism. Causes are generally normal wear and tear.
Symptoms of a bad latch include:
- The door not closing fully or popping open accidentally
- Inability to fully lock or latch no matter how hard the door is pressed
- Damaged or stripped screws holding the mechanism

The Tub Gasket is an OEM part for GE dishwashers. It is installed around the perimeter of the dishwasher door to create a water-tight seal during operation, effectively preventing water leaks. This gasket ensures that the dishwasher can maintain the necessary water level and pressure to clean dishes effectively, while also protecting your kitchen from water damage.
Causes of a bad Tub Gasket can include natural wear and tear from regular use, exposure to harsh cleaning chemicals that can degrade the rubber material, or improper installation leading to gaps or loosening.
Symptoms of a bad Tub Gasket include:
- Water leaking from around the dishwasher door
- Signs of mold or mildew on the gasket
- The gasket becoming hard or cracked
- Visible gaps between the gasket and the dishwasher door

The Heating Element is an OEM part for GE dishwashers. It is responsible for heating the water during the wash cycles and for drying the dishes after the rinse cycle. Proper functioning of the heating element ensures optimal cleaning and drying performance.
Causes of a bad heating element can include mineral buildup from hard water, electrical faults, or general wear and tear over time. Damage to the heating coil or connections can also impair its functionality.
Symptoms of a bad heating element include:
- Dishes not drying properly
- Dishwasher cycles taking longer than usual
- Water not heating during the wash cycle
- Error codes related to heating issues

The Flood Switch Assembly is an OEM part for GE dishwashers that is responsible for detecting water levels in the dishwasher's base, preventing potential flooding by shutting off the water intake if an overflow is detected. This helps in avoiding water damage to your home and ensuring the dishwasher operates normally.
Symptoms of a bad Flood Switch Assembly include:
- The dishwasher not filling with water
- Water not draining properly
- The dishwasher stops during a cycle
Causes of a bad flood switch assembly can vary from debris accumulation affecting the float's movement to electrical issues within the switch mechanism. Over time, wear and tear on the float or switch can lead to failures.

The Detergent Module is an OEM replacement part for GE dishwashers. It is designed to dispense the correct amount of detergent at the appropriate times during the wash cycle, ensuring that dishes are cleaned effectively. The module holds the detergent and releases it into the dishwasher when needed, contributing to the overall performance and efficiency of the appliance.
Causes of a bad detergent module can include buildup of detergent residues, which can clog the dispenser mechanism, or damage to the module's door or latch, preventing it from opening correctly. Additionally, electrical faults or wear and tear over time can impair the module's functionality, leading to ineffective detergent dispensing.
Symptoms of a bad detergent module include:
- The detergent not dispensing or remaining in the compartment after the wash cycle
- Dishes not being cleaned properly due to insufficient detergent use
- The module door not opening or closing correctly
- Leaks or drips from the detergent module area
- Error codes related to the dispensing system

The Door Cable is an OEM part for GE dishwashers, designed to support and assist in the smooth and controlled opening and closing of the dishwasher door. This cable connects the door to the spring mechanism, providing the necessary tension to balance the door's weight during operation.
Signs that you might need to replace the Door Cable include the door suddenly dropping open or being difficult to raise, indicating a break or excessive wear.
Symptoms of a bad Door Cable include:
- The dishwasher door slamming open or requiring extra force to close.
- Unusual noises when opening or closing the door, suggesting the cable is not running smoothly.
- Difficulty in keeping the door partially open, affecting loading and unloading dishes.

The Drain Tube is an OEM part for GE dishwashers. This tube is responsible for carrying wastewater from the dishwasher to the household drain, ensuring efficient and effective removal of dirty water during and after the wash cycle. The drain tube helps maintain the dishwasher's performance by preventing water from pooling inside the appliance.
Over time, drain tubes can become clogged, cracked, or worn out due to regular use or debris buildup. Common causes of a bad drain tube include blockages from food particles, mineral deposits, wear and tear from frequent use, or damage from improper installation or handling.
Symptoms of a bad drain tube include:
- Water not draining from the dishwasher
- Leaks around the dishwasher area
- Unpleasant odors due to standing water
- Visible cracks, splits, or kinks in the tube
